The Partisan Republican Power Grab for the Harford County Board of Education
Harford County Republicans are shifting the goalposts to ensure they maintain control of the Harford County Board of Education. This partisan Republican power grab is being orchestrated through HB 283 and SB 382. The bills focus on changing the terms of the appointed board members and who gets to select them.
